Have you tried a tool like SEO4Firefox to analyze the pages on the first page? Finding out how many links they have will give you a blueprint on what you need to beat them.

If you have more backlinks than sites ranking ahead of you, then their backlinks are probably more relevant... search the sites out that link to them and get them to link to you as well.
